Project Overview

FDOT District Six recently started a PD&E Study for SR 826/Palmetto Expressway from US 1/SR 5/Dixie Highway to SR 836/Dolphin Expressway, a distance of approximately seven miles. The PD&E Study is proposing corridor improvements that will add highway and interchange capacity with the implementation of an express lanes system and interchange improvements. The project is located in Miami-Dade County, Florida and is contained within unincorporated Miami-Dade. The PD&E Study will evaluate the following potential types of improvements:

  • Implementation of dynamically priced express lanes.
  • Access and ramp connections to and from the express lanes (ingress and egress access points).
  • Interchange improvements – Modification of existing entrance and exit ramps serving the interchanges within the project limits.
  • Intersection improvements – Widening and turn lane modifications along the cross streets to facilitate the ramp modifications and improve the access and operation of the corridors upstream and downstream from the interchanges.
